Abstract: Methods, apparatus and systems for determining a transport block size in a wireless communication are disclosed. In one embodiment, a method performed by a wireless communication device is disclosed. The method comprises: receiving control information from a wireless communication node, wherein the control information includes a plurality of transmission parameters related to transport blocks to be transmitted between the wireless communication device and the wireless communication node; calculating an intermediate transport block size (TBS) for the transport blocks based on the plurality of transmission parameters; modifying the intermediate TBS to generate a modified TBS in response to an event that the intermediate TBS is smaller than a threshold; and determining a final TBS for the transport blocks based on a TBS that is closest to the modified TBS, among TBSs that are in a quantized set and not smaller than the modified TBS.

Abstract: Systems, methods and devices for control channel monitoring may include a wireless communication device reporting, to a wireless communication node, a plurality of capabilities of the wireless communication device. The wireless communication device may receive, from the wireless communication node, control information. The wireless communication device perform physical downlink control channel (PDCCH) monitoring using a group of search space sets (SSSs) selected from a plurality of search space set groups (SSSGs) or PDCCH skipping using a skipping duration according to the control information. The number of SSSG can be an integer N that is not smaller than 1, or each of the SSSGs can include a number of SSSs that is at least zero and at most equal to a maximum number of SSSs configured in a bandwidth part (BWP). The number of skipping duration values can be an integer M greater than or equal to 0.
